Neville's Inner Vision
This passage is a study in consciousness. The strangers and the alien symbolize inner faculties and resources your imagination can claim; the outer support mirrors your inner state. When you declare, I am the Priests of the LORD, you align with a divine order within and wealth becomes the natural fruit of that alignment. The 'ministers of our God' express through daily service born from this state, and the riches of the Gentiles become energy drawn from the greater Mind, a covenant reward for loyal inner allegiance. It is not about external possessions so much as the shift of your inner disposition; the outer world simply reflects the stature you assume inwardly. Cultivate fidelity to this inner priesthood, and provision flows as a visible sign of your spiritual identity made real.
